Article 5 Travel agencies shall be divided into international travel agencies and domestic travel agencies according to their line The business scope of international travel agencies covers the business of inbound and outbound tourists and domestic tourists. The business scope of domestic travel agencies is limited to domestic tourist businesses only. CHAPTER II ESTABLISHMENT OF TRAVEL AGENCIES Article 6 Those establishing travel agencies shall meet the following conditions: 1. Fixed business venues. 2. Necessary business facilities. 3. Business personnel who have received training and qualification certificates from tourism administration departments 4. Registered capital and quality assurance funds as stipulated in articles 7 and 8 of these Regulations. Article 7 The registered capital of travel agencies shall meet the following conditions: 1. No less than 1.5 million Renminbi yuan for international travel agencies. 2. No less than 300,000 Renminbi yuan for domestic travel agencies. Article 8 Those applying for the establishment of travel agencies shall pay tourism administration departments quality assurance funds according 1. 600,000 Renminbi yuan for international travel agencies handling inbound tourist businesses and 1 million Renminbi 2. 100,000 Renminbi yuan for domestic travel agencies. Public notices Article 15 Travel agencies that receive more than 100,000 people/time a year may set up branches without legal person status (hereinafter International travel agencies shall increase their registered capital by 750,000 Renminbi yuan and their assurance funds by 300,000 Travel agencies and their branches shall exercise unified management, have unified finance, and solicit and receive tourists The branches set up by travel agencies shall subject themselves to the supervision and management by tourism administrations Article 16 Those applying for the establishment of Sino-foreign equity or contractual travel agency joint ventures shall go through procedures Article 17 Foreign travel agencies that set up resident offices in the People’s Republic of China shall report for approval to the tourism These resident offices can only take up tourism consulting, liaison, and promotion work. They shall not engage in tourism businesses. CHAPTER III MANAGEMENT OF TRAVEL AGENCIES Article 18 Travel agencies shall conduct businesses within specified business scope. Travel agencies shall observe the principle of voluntariness, equality, fairness, honesty, and creditability; and conform with Article 19 When conducting tourism businesses, travel agencies shall not, resort to illegitimate tricks as listed below to harm (1) Imitation of the trademarks of other travel agencies. (2) Unauthorized use of the post_titles of other travel agencies. (3) Defamation of other travel agencies. (4) Entrustment of tourism businesses to units other than travel agencies or individuals not working with travel agencies. (5) Other behaviours that disturb the order of tourism markets. Article 20 Written contracts shall be signed between travel agencies and their employees to prescribe their respective rights and obligations. Without approval from travel agencies, employees shall not disclose or use the commercial secrets of these agencies or allow Article 21 Travel agencies shall safeguard the legitimate rights and interests of tourists. Travel agencies shall provide tourists with true and reliable information. They shall not carry out false publicity activities. Article 22 When organizing sightseeing activities, travel agencies shall buy casualty insurance for tourists and see to it that the services Article 23 Travelling services provided by travel agencies to tourists shall be charged according to State stipulations. If travel agencies Travel agencies shall present service vouches to tourists in line with relevant State stipulations if they provide services with Article 24 Tourists shall have the right to lodge complaints with tourism administrations should they suffer losses from any one of (1) Failure of travel agencies to meet standards on service quality as specified in contracts due to their own faults. (2) Failure of travel agencies to meet State or sectorial standards when providing services. (3) Loss of down payments by tourists due to bankruptcy of travel agencies. Tourism administrations shall hear complaints of tourists and handle cases in line with stipulations of these Regulations.
